"""Online rollout runner for RL training.
|
|
|
|
Provides:
|
|
- :class:`RawRollout` — generation output container (no reward yet)
|
|
- :class:`RolloutResult` — a :class:`RawRollout` with rewards attached
|
|
- :class:`BaseRewardModel` — pluggable reward interface
|
|
- :class:`RolloutGenerator` — KV-cache-backed generation of grouped
|
|
responses + decoding (no reward); delegates the generation loop to
|
|
:class:`~astrai.inference.scheduler.InferenceScheduler.run_batch`
|
|
so rollout and the production inference server share one code path
|
|
- :class:`RolloutRunner` — orchestrates generation + scoring with a
|
|
step-driven cache; its ``__call__`` returns ``(RolloutResult, is_fresh)``
|
|
so callers do not need to rely on object identity to detect refreshes.
|
|
"""

@dataclass(kw_only=True)
|
|
class RawRollout:
|
|
"""Generation output before reward scoring.
|
|
|
|
Produced by :class:`RolloutGenerator`; consumed by :class:`RolloutRunner`
|
|
to assemble a :class:`RolloutResult` once rewards are attached.
|
|
|
|
Fields are designed to cover all common RL algorithms:
|
|
GRPO, PPO, Online DPO, Rejection Sampling, etc.
|
|
|
|
Fields:
|
|
prompts: Tokenized prompts, shape ``[B, P_len]``.
|
|
prompt_mask: Boolean mask for real prompt tokens, shape ``[B, P_len]``.
|
|
responses: Generated response token IDs, shape ``[B, G, R_max]``.
|
|
response_mask: Boolean mask for real (non-pad) response tokens,
|
|
shape ``[B, G, R_max]``.
|
|
logprobs_old: Per-token log-probs under the behaviour policy,
|
|
shape ``[B, G, R_max]``.
|
|
prompt_texts: Decoded prompt strings (for reward models that
|
|
need text).
|
|
response_texts: Decoded response strings, shape ``[B, G]``
|
|
(for reward models).
|
|
"""
|
|
|
|
prompts: Tensor
|
|
prompt_mask: Tensor
|
|
responses: Tensor
|
|
response_mask: Tensor
|
|
logprobs_old: Tensor
|
|
policy_version: int = 0
|
|
prompt_texts: List[str] = field(default_factory=list)
|
|
response_texts: List[List[str]] = field(default_factory=list)
|
|
|
|
|
|
@dataclass(kw_only=True)
|
|
class RolloutResult(RawRollout):
|
|
"""A :class:`RawRollout` with reward scoring attached.
|
|
|
|
Produced by :class:`RolloutRunner` once the :class:`BaseRewardModel`
|
|
has scored the decoded responses.
|
|
|
|
Fields:
|
|
rewards: Reward per response, shape ``[B, G]``.
|
|
"""
|
|
|
|
rewards: Tensor
|
|
|
|
|
|
class BaseRewardModel(ABC):
|
|
"""Pluggable reward model interface.
|
|
|
|
Subclasses should implement ``score()`` to return a ``[B, G]`` float
|
|
tensor of rewards. Implementations can be:
|
|
* A loaded reward model (e.g. ArmoRM, Skywork-Reward)
|
|
* An external API call
|
|
* A rule-based function (format, length, keyword matching)
|
|
"""
|
|
|
|
@abstractmethod
|
|
def score(self, prompts: List[str], responses: List[List[str]]) -> Tensor:
|
|
"""Score each generated response.
|
|
|
|
Args:
|
|
prompts: Raw prompt strings, length ``B``.
|
|
responses: Generated response strings, shape ``[B, G]``.
|
|
|
|
Returns:
|
|
Float tensor of shape ``[B, G]``.
|
|
"""
|
|
...
|
|
|
|
|
|
_PAD = 0
|
|
|
|
|
|
class RolloutGenerator:
|
|
"""Pure generation + decoding for a group of responses per prompt.
|
|
|
|
Delegates the prefill/decode loop to
|
|
:meth:`~astrai.inference.scheduler.InferenceScheduler.run_batch`,
|
|
which uses a real KV cache (no O(n²) recompute). Has no dependency
|
|
on any reward model; can be reused in isolation for offline
|
|
generation, qualitative sampling, or eval pipelines.
|
|
"""
